On average across the year,
no, North Macedonia is not hotter than
Pinellas Park, Florida
.
North Macedonia has an average temperature of 13°C/55°F and Pinellas Park, Florida has an average temperature of 24°C/75°F.
North Macedonia's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F, which is not hotter than Pinellas Park, Florida's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 33°C/91°F).
On average across the year, yes, North Macedonia is colder than Pinellas Park, Florida . North Macedonia has an average minimum temperature of 7°C/45°F and Pinellas Park, Florida has an average minimum temperature of 19°C/66°F.
On average across the year,
no, North Macedonia has less rain than
Pinellas Park, Florida. North Macedonia has an average annual rainfall of 392mm and Pinellas Park, Florida has an average annual rainfall of 1519mm.
North Macedonia's wettest month is May, with an average monthly rainfall of 42mm, which is drier than Pinellas Park, Florida's wettest month (August, with an average monthly rainfall of 303mm).

Yes, North Macedonia is more populated than Pinellas Park.
North Macedonia has a population of 2,130,936 and Pinellas Park has a population of 51,617
which means that North Macedonia has 2,079,319 more people than Pinellas Park.
That makes North Macedonia 41 times more populated than Pinellas Park.
